1) Heap-based buffer overflow (CVE-ID: CVE-2017-17498)

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error in WritePNMImage in coders/pnm.c in GraphicsMagick 1.3.26. A remote attacker can use a crafted file. to trigger heap-based buffer overflow and execute arbitrary code on the target system.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.


Remediation

Install update from vendor's website.
